Anyone got th link, reformatted my pc since last used it.
Dont mean the main dealer service website.
Its for the likes of group N engine mounts etc.
iirc its a french website with english language selection.
Try get a list going, but without the spam please.
Could be made a sticky in future if we get good responses
Dont mean the main dealer service website.
Its for the likes of group N engine mounts etc.
iirc its a french website with english language selection.
Try get a list going, but without the spam please.
Could be made a sticky in future if we get good responses
